流程控制 有 if else 和 switch case ,目的在根據不同的條件,執行不同的操作。我們今天先來認識 if else,明天再接續認識 switch case。 if 判斷式 if 的後...
隨著 JavaScript 的官方標準 ES6 開始支援模組化之後,經過了七年的時間,就像戰國時代,秦國一統天下。JavaScript 也是如此,在這之前,模組化的方式由不同的社群制定,並大力推廣自己...
題目 解題想法 function convertToArray(grid){ for(let i=0;i<grid.length;i++){ grid[i] = gri...
函式 函式宣告 用 function就可以了,不會區分回傳值。 function add(num1,num2){ return num1 + num2; } document.write(ad...
Webpack 它為了解決什麼問題而生? 正如我在 Day 03 提過的,在各種執行環境、規格、版本、語法大亂鬥的時代,把開發環境的程式碼與資料轉換成適合佈署到執行環境的格式便是一個常見的需求,Web...
前言 先前介紹變數的時候MDN說過 變數(variable)是對值(value)的引用。 值的變更與運算是所有程式語言大部分時間在處理的事情, 而JavaScript是一種弱型別(weakly t...
tags: iThome 鐵人賽 30天 今天就來接續昨天的基本語法吧! JavaScript重要基本語法 Automatic Semicolon Insertion (ASI) 當JavaScrip...
變數的原始型別-字串 繼昨天的布林、undefined、null之後介紹原始型別-字串 宣告字串 let a = 'hello'; 變數類型 變數名稱...
變數的原始型別 大致了解過let、const、var所宣告的變數後開始來了解變數的原始型別吧。 一共有七種 Primitive 字串(String) 數字(Number) 布林(Boolean) 物...
經過昨天的範例分析應該也能較為熟悉JavaScript抓取網頁元素並提供修改,同時也會應用迴圈的部分。今天要來說明JavaScript比較常抓取的網頁元素有哪些。 建置HTML網頁內容 首先先拿前幾天...